woodhog14

Quote from: hogcard1964 on September 25, 2016, 07:22:12 am
How come we were really good in 2010 and 2011 and now we're just average?

In 2010 the SEC didn't have aTm...and Ole Miss and State were not as near as good as they have been lately.
Ole Miss was 1-7 in SEC play
State was 3-5 in SEC play
We still lost to Bama, who finished 5-3 in SEC play

In 2011 the SEC didn't have aTm...
Ole Miss was 0-8 in SEC play
State was 1-7 in SEC play
Auburn was 4-4 in SEC play
We got smoked by the two best SEC teams by a combined score of 79-31.
